Super User Catch and Grease Posted September 15, 2014 Author Super User Posted September 15, 2014 Well I'm actually quite proud of myself because I applied all the information you guys gave me in those big bass threads on that day and it paided off. WRB mentioned fishing around depth changes in the trees so I found a spot with lots of big bass forage like bream and such and it had good depth changes an plenty of cover, so I got out the jig and started moving tree to tree fishing the jig slow. I was throwing the jig out and letting it sink, id let it sit on the bottom motionless then shake it alittle in case a bass followed it on the fall. If a bass didn't get it at that point id start hoping and dragging it really slow back to the boat then rinse and repeat. Quote
